Why is October 1st 1960 an important date in the history of Nigeria?

Independence Day is an official national holiday in Nigeria, celebrated on the 1st of October. It marks Nigeria’s proclamation of independence from British rule on 1 October 1960.

What happened in Nigeria in 1960s?

1960 – Independence, with Prime Minister Sir Abubakar Tafawa Balewa leading a coalition government. 1966 January – Mr Balewa killed in coup. Maj-Gen Johnson Aguiyi-Ironsi forms military government. 1966 July – General Ironsi killed in counter-coup, replaced by Lieutenant-Colonel Yakubu Gowon.

When did Nigeria gain independence from British rule?

33. Nigeria (1960-present) Pre-Crisis Phase (October 1, 1960-January 14, 1966): The Federation of Nigeria formally achieved its independence from Britain and joined the Commonwealth of Nations (CON) on October 1, 1960.
